2.3 Scope of delivery

Temperature dry-well calibrator model CTD9100-1100
Power cord, 1.5 m [5 ft] with safety plug
Insert with four bores: 7 mm, 9 mm, 11 mm and 13.5 mm
[0.28 in, 0.35 in, 0.43 in and 0.53 in]
Drilled ceramic top insulator
Insert replacement tools
Connection cable
Operating instructions
Calibration certificate
Cross-check scope of delivery with delivery note.

The calibrators/micro calibration baths are
delivered in special protective packaging.
The packaging must be set aside so that the
calibrator or the micro calibration bath can
be sent safely back to the manufacturer for
recalibration or repair.
The equalizing block is packed separately to
avoid breaking the ceramic tube during transport.
The block must be fitted into the calibrator when
it is ready to be used.

3.2 Intended use

The temperature dry-well calibrator is a portable unit, for
service functions and also for industrial and laboratory
tasks. The temperature dry-well calibrator is provided for
the calibration of thermometers, temperature switches/
thermostats, resistance thermometers and thermocouples.
The operational safety of the delivered instruments is only
assured if the equipment is employed for its intended use
(verification of temperature sensors). The given limit values
should never be exceeded (see chapter 12 "Specifications").
The appropriate instrument should be selected depending on
the application; it should be connected correctly, tests carried
out and all components serviced.
This instrument is not permitted to be used in hazardous
areas!
The instrument has been designed and built solely for
the intended use described here, and may only be used
accordingly.
The technical specifications contained in these operating
instructions must be observed. Improper handling or
operation of the instrument outside of its technical
specifications requires the instrument to be taken out of
service immediately and inspected by an authorised WIKA
service engineer.
